At the close of the 1992-93 school year, Akiva consolidated the positions of upper- and low- er-school secular studies princi- pals into one role. Akiva, like other area Jewish day schools, divides its hours be- tween secular and Judaic stud- ies. Ms. Lake admits some areas of education, like arts and ath- letics, must be fostered outside of the school due to lack of time. She believes day schools are successful because "the students and families are committed to ed- ucation. The children are asked to be the best students in half the time." In addition, she views Akiva students, as a rule, "more fo- cused" than their public-school peers. "Most of them know upon graduation they'll go to Israel. It's part of their plan. And most leave knowing which college they'll attend upon their return." Ms. Lake plans to spend the summer meeting with teachers, determining their hopes and needs to build a cohesive ap- proach to social and academic is- sues. Independent schools, Ms. Lake said, allow for the oppor- tunity to research and quickly implement problem-solving de- cisions. Her long-term plans include learning Hebrew and reentering the classroom part time. "At the Valley School I taught an hour of fifth-grade math. It was my fa- vorite part of the day," Ms. Lake said. Ms. Lake pursued her career after spending time volunteer- ing . "I was the mom who was al- ways at my children's school. I enjoyed it so much I went back to get my degree in education.
